Shipping Coordinator information

What is a shipping coordinator?

A shipping coordinator is in charge of overseeing inbound and outbound packages for transportation. As a shipping coordinator, your job duties include communicating with shippers to provide rates, managing large quantities of packages, and assisting with various routing tasks. You also track packages already en route to their destination. Because this job is considered entry-level, it’s a great way to launch your career in shipping. Qualifications include prior customer service experience, basic accounting and computing skills, and excellent communication skills. Being highly organized is also an essential trait for duties like managing invoices. This position is ideal for those looking to learn more about the shipping industry.

What does a shipping coordinator do?

A Shipping Coordinator is responsible for overseeing and managing the shipment of goods from a warehouse or production facility to their destination. This includes preparing shipping documents, coordinating with carriers and logistics companies, tracking shipments, and ensuring that deliveries are made on time. Shipping Coordinators also handle any issues that may arise during transit, such as delays or damages, and communicate with customers and internal teams to keep everyone updated. Their role is vital for ensuring efficient and cost-effective delivery processes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a shipping coordinator,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Shipping Coordinator,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a background in logistics or supply chain management, often supported by a relevant associate degree or experience. Familiarity with shipping software, inventory management systems, and knowledge of freight documentation are typically required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and time management skills help you coordinate with vendors, carriers, and internal teams effectively. These competencies ensure timely and accurate shipments, minimize errors, and support smooth operations in a fast-paced logistics environment.

How does a shipping coordinator typically collaborate with warehouse and logistics teams to ensure timely deliveries?

A Shipping Coordinator plays a vital role in bridging communication between warehouse staff and logistics providers. They are responsible for scheduling pickups, preparing necessary shipping documentation, and tracking outgoing shipments to ensure deadlines are met. Regular coordination with warehouse teams helps validate inventory availability, while frequent updates to logistics partners minimize delays and address issues proactively. This collaborative approach helps maintain efficient shipping operations and high customer satisfaction.

What is the difference between Shipping Coordinator vs Warehouse Associate?

AspectShipping CoordinatorWarehouse Associate
Primary ResponsibilitiesOversees shipping processes, coordinates with carriers, manages documentationHandles inventory, moves goods within warehouse, prepares items for shipment
Required SkillsLogistics knowledge, communication, organizationPhysical stamina, inventory management, forklift operation
Work EnvironmentOffice and shipping areas, often in logistics or distribution centersWarehouse floors, storage areas, distribution centers
Common CertificationsNone typically required, but logistics or supply chain certifications can helpForklift certification often preferred

While both roles support the supply chain, the Shipping Coordinator focuses on managing shipping logistics and documentation, whereas the Warehouse Associate handles physical inventory and prepares goods for shipment.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right career path or job search focus.

Position Summary

The General Clerk III provides administrative and applicant-processing support to Army Guidance Counselors and Senior Guidance Counselors. The position prepares and tracks enlistment and medical-processing records, performs document quality control, maintains applicant files and suspense actions, and coordinates with military, civilian, recruiting, and medical personnel.

Primary Duties
  • Receive, review, organize, and process applicant records, enlistment packets, medical documentation, waivers, source documents, and other supporting materials.
  • Report incoming applicant correspondence and scan or upload required documents, including DD Form 2807-2 information, into MIRS and other authorized Government systems.
  • Review applicant records for accuracy, completeness, consistency, and legibility, and perform quality-control checks on Army personnel packets.
  • Maintain MEPS medical and action logs, suspense files, tracking reports, and paper and electronic applicant records.
  • Track medical waivers, consultations, appointments, administrative holds, and processing deadlines; process new record requests within required timelines and conduct follow-ups every 72 business hours until issues are resolved.
  • Monitor applicant status in MIRS, MHS Genesis, Recruiter Zone, and related systems; verify source-document information, Live Scan results, shipper status, and other required applicant data.
  • Support service-processing actions, high-school record requests, MEPS-to-MEPS transfers, medical-document processing, and administrative-hold resolution.
  • Communicate daily with Guidance Counselors, recruiters, medical personnel, Government staff, schools, courts, record repositories, and other organizations, and keep the Senior Guidance Counselor informed of applicant status.
  • Prepare correspondence, reports, and administrative documents using established Army formats and procedures.
  • Operate computers, scanners, printers, copiers, telephones, email, fax equipment, and other standard office equipment.
  • Safeguard personally identifiable information, protected health information, Government records, and Controlled Unclassified Information.
  • Maintain a professional and orderly workplace and complete all required Government and Army training.
